    .32 ACP Lehigh Cavitator and Beretta Tomcat

    I've seen a few posts about how this round as factory ammo from Lehigh or Underwood doesn't feed reliably in the tomcat. I ordered some bullets and loaded some up with Universal in new Starline cases. I only put 14 rounds downrange but so far so good. I'll load up and shoot the other 30 (and shoot the other 6 I loaded up originally) and see how they run.

    I'm wondering if anyone here has used the factory loaded 50 grain Extreme Cavitator that is available from Lehigh and (was) available at Underwood. I'm seating and crimping with the Lee seating/crimping die (not the factory crimp die), enough to round to take out the flair and a bit more.

    Now 14 rounds isn't enough to say it's 100% reliable, I know that, but from other accounts other people seem to be having issues right off the bat. I'm wondering if that slight bit of crimp is the magic to keep the round from getting hung up or am I just lucky?
